Race against time: bringing Hospital-Level heart rescue to the scene
NCT ID NCT07374289
Summary
This study is testing whether starting a special advanced life support machine (called ECMO) right at the scene of a cardiac arrest, instead of waiting until the patient reaches the hospital, leads to better survival and brain recovery. It will compare two groups of patients: one that gets the treatment on-scene by a mobile medical team, and another that receives it after arriving at the hospital. The main goal is to see if starting treatment faster saves more lives and preserves brain function.
